Bluffing

Bluffing is an essential aspect of poker and can be employed to increase your chances of winning pots. But, it is important to understand that not every bluff can be successful, and you must be selective in the time you make them. It is best to only bluff one person at a given time. This is more effective than bluffing several players. It is also crucial to examine the opponent's recent history, as this can determine if they are likely to be a suitable candidate to fool.

You can also identify a fraud by watching the body language of the opponent. If a player is swaying their head or touching his face, it could be a tactic to hide indications of vulnerability. In addition, looking at their betting patterns can give important clues about the level of their hand.

The position of the player and the actions of other players are also crucial factors to take into consideration before deciding to bluff. For example when you're in a the late position and your opponent is checking, you can usually presume them to have an unsound hand and bet. If the opponent is tight or doesn't seem to be interested in the pot, then they may not be the right target for a bet.

Another thing to consider is the way your opponent behaves after being bluffed by you. Some players go on tilt and continue to be reckless after a loss and others will be more tense in an attempt to recover their losses. In either case, your game must be re-evaluated to compensate for the changes. By knowing when and when to bluff, you can maximize your EV and earn more.
